Я видел довольно много сообщений о проблемах отладки приложений React Native, хотя ни одно из них не является той же самой проблемой, что и у меня.
Проблема в том, что я ставлю debugger
'В моем коде везде, где мне нужно что-то проверить, и даже при достижении точек останова, которые я ставлю, консоль JS в Chrome никогда не показывает мне, куда я помещаю debugger
, и поэтому я никогда не могу проверить значения должным образом.
Просто для примера, у меня может быть что-то вроде этого:
...
const myVar = someFunction();
debugger;
Когда я запускаю код, он приостанавливает выполнение где-то в моем коде, но никогда там, где debugger
.И если бы я проверял значение myVar
, оно всегда показывает undefined
.
Я использую VS Code
на Windows 10
против эмулятора, который идет с Android Studio
.Также удаленная отладка работает на Chrome
.Я также хочу отметить, что все упомянутое здесь программное обеспечение, включая ОС, полностью обновлено.
Отладка приложения React Native - это всегда плохой опыт - на основании множества жалоб, которые яПонимаете?
Это также плохой опыт на Mac?
Хотя я не думаю, что это проблема, это могут быть инструменты, которые я использую?Я думаю, что VS Code
, Chrome
и Android Studio
- это в значительной степени то, что использует большинство людей - будь то на ПК или Mac.
Любая идея, как я могу иметь приличный опыт в отладкемои приложения React Native?